Merge pull request #291596 from nim65s/eigenpy-3.4.0

python311Packages.eigenpy: 3.3.0 -> 3.4.0
This commit is contained in:
Weijia Wang 2024-02-27 08:47:42 +01:00 committed by GitHub
commit 805bca88c5
No known key found for this signature in database
GPG Key ID: B5690EEEBB952194

View File

@ -2,27 +2,36 @@
, stdenv
, fetchFromGitHub
, cmake
, doxygen
, boost
, eigen
, numpy
, scipy
}:
stdenv.mkDerivation (finalAttrs: {
pname = "eigenpy";
version = "3.3.0";
version = "3.4.0";
src = fetchFromGitHub {
owner = "stack-of-tasks";
repo = finalAttrs.pname;
rev = "v${finalAttrs.version}";
fetchSubmodules = true;
hash = "sha256-INOg1oL5APMI2YZDe4yOJadhMsG7b+NfEcSr9FsdqeU=";
hash = "sha256-/k5eltoeUW05FTjvStAOw+tguWLUaUced8TArrk4UDI=";
};
cmakeFlags = [
"-DINSTALL_DOCUMENTATION=ON"
"-DBUILD_TESTING_SCIPY=ON"
];
strictDeps = true;
nativeBuildInputs = [
cmake
doxygen
scipy
];
buildInputs = [